Movie-Themed Wrap Of Monorail Irks Some Disney World Visitors

A flashy ad display wrapped around a Disney World monorail train has purist tourists up in arms, reports Jason Garcia of the Orlando Sentinel. The advertising is part of Disney's early marketing campaign for the movie "Tron: Legacy," and features the image of a motorcycle on the front cab with a yellow trail of light extending the length of the train. It's the first time Disney World has wrapped a monorail with advertising that promotes something other than its theme parks.

"What's next, billboards on Cinderella's Castle?" asks one commenter on the company-run theme-park blog. "You get the feeling that over the years, the hard sell has been creeping in further and further," says Michael Crawford, publisher of Progress City USA, a blog devoted to Disney news and history.

But a Disney spokesman points out that the "Tron"-wrapped monorail travels only to its Epcot theme park, which, like the movie, has a technology-heavy theme. "Our parks are where our stories come to life and, if there's a natural fit to bring in a new story, then we consider it," says Bryan Malenius.
